[vdr] Re: ANNOUNCE: vdrchannels-0.0.4
> What about the possibility to enter regular expressions in the
> vdrchannels.conf? So I could say:
> Premiere.*
> .*ARD.*
> and all matching channels are inserted here.
I had this in mind.
A definition like
PW $1:Premiere ([0-9]*)
(Perl enthusiast could read that ;-))
would be possible, but what about the order.
The order would be fe. alphabetic, but than it would be
Premiere 1
Premiere 10
Premiere 2
...
Dont know if there are more than 10 channels for Premiere. All I want to
show with this example, that the order is not easy to manage. In the
alias part of VDRCHANNELS this would be possible.
> And what I had in my script is a negation-flag to NOT show a channel
> -Astra.*
> will exclude all Astra-Channels, even from the :_others section.
OK, that could be a new feature.
Suggestion: What would be about a ":_deny" section and every Channel
listed behind would not be used in the ":_others" section?
